流程 创建一个excel文件 获取当前的活动sheet标签 通过行列坐标获取单元格,并向其插入数据(这里有2种方式) 生成文件并输入 代码预览 phpgetactivesheet(); //获取当前活动sheet标签$osheet->settitle('demo');//填充数据 方式一// $osheet->setcellvalue('a1', '姓名')->setcellvalue('b1', '性别')->setcellvalue('c1', '年龄');// $osheet->setcellvalue('a2', '射可可')->setcellvalue('b2', '男')->setcellvalue('c2', '21');// $osheet->setcellvalue('a3', 'uzi')->setcellvalue('b3', '男')->setcellvalue('c3', '18');// $osheet->setcellvalue('a4', 'zero')->setcellvalue('b4', '男')->setcellvalue('c4', '20');//填充数据方式二 数组方式$adata = array( array('姓名', '分数'), array('曹鹏', '99'), array('童话', '66'), array(), //数组的方式是按顺序一个一个元素进行读取,这里空数组会生成一个空行 array('风云', '82'),);$osheet->fromarray($adata); //加载数组数据//保存$owrite = phpexcel_iofactory::createwriter($ophpexcel, 'excel2007');$owrite->save($dir.'/demo_array.xls');?>
结果